AtlasMNS tracks location, weather simultaneously

updated 12:40 pm EST, Tue January 2, 2007

 

Brunton AtlasMNS GPS


Brunton's portable Atlas MNS is unusual for a GPS unit in that it has dual processors, which allows it to not only track your position, but to take barometer readings and create a weather forecast for the next 12 hours. It can also rememeber the weather of the last 36 hours, and has atlas, altimeter, and digital compass functions. The unit's internal memory can be supplemented by external SD and MMC cards, and supports up to 10 routes, 100 plot trails, and 1,000 waypoints and 1,000 event markers. Power is supplied by two AA batteries and will last up to two weeks in compass mode, but drops to 12 hours in continuous GPS mode. The housing is waterproof and submersible. Brunton is selling the AtlasMNS for $359, but Optics Planet has it for $20 less. [Via NaviGadget]
